Saudi Aramco, the world’s largest oil company, said on Tuesday that it had earned $42.4 billion in net income in the third quarter. The figure was more than double the nearly $20 billion that Exxon Mobil earned for the period.It also enabled Saudi Aramco, which is state-controlled and has a near-monopoly on Saudi Arabia’s oil output, to pay a large dividend — $18.75 billion — mostly to the country’s government.Aramco is the latest oil... + full article

DUBAI, United Arab Emirates (AP) — Oil giant Saudi Aramco on Tuesday reported a $42.4 billion profit in the third quarter of this year, a 39% bump buoyed by the higher global energy prices that have filled the kingdom’s coffers but helped fuel inflation worldwide.The oil... + más
